Dropping Out
The act of leaving a course of study or training before completion, often referring to high school or college education.
Grade Inflation
The tendency over time to award higher academic grades for work that would have received lower grades in the past, often criticized for reducing standards.
SAT Scores
Standardized test scores used for college admissions in the United States, assessing mathematical, reading, and writing skills.
Independent Measures
An experimental design in which different participants are used in each condition of the experiment.
